Hello, I'm

Welcome to my Portfolio! Feel free to look around, or contact me!

hero image

Projects

Certifications

+

Languages

+

Years

coding person illustration

About Me

Since I was eight years old, I have had a profound connection with computers. My fascination with video games led me to explore how they worked, fueling my interest in both art and math. During high school, I discovered the harmony between art and math through coding. I completed various coding courses, including Java, Android Development, Web Development, C#, and Unity Game Development. The summer before my senior year, I participated in an online web development bootcamp, which solidified my passion for coding.

Since then, I have dedicated a significant portion of my free time to exploring code and learning new technologies. I recently graduated from the Software Development program at Tooele Technical College, further enhancing my skills and knowledge in the field. Throughout my journey, I have developed a deep understanding of NextJS, React, and NodeJS, which I consider my core technical strengths.

As a newly graduated software developer, I am excited to apply my skills in real-world scenarios and continue growing in this dynamic field. I am committed to staying at the forefront of software development trends, constantly learning and expanding my capabilities. My goal is to contribute innovative solutions to challenging problems and make a meaningful impact in the tech industry.

I am eager to collaborate with like-minded professionals, tackle complex projects, and further refine my expertise in software development. With a solid foundation and an insatiable curiosity for technology, I look forward to the next chapter in my career as a software developer.

Skills, Education and Certifications

  • NextJS
  • React
  • Tailwind
  • MongoDB
  • NodeJS
  • HTML5
  • CSS
  • Javascript
  • Java
  • XML
  • C#
  • Python
  • Unity Game Engine
  • Blender
  • Visual Studio
  • Visual Studio Code
  • Android Studio
  • Raspberry Pi

My Projects

Featured Project

Floor 666

Floor 666: A VR Horror Experience

Floor 666: A VR Horror Experience

Floor 666 is my first large VR project, developed completely alone. Although I did not create the models and textures, I did create the game mechanics and the level design. You play as a journalist, investigating the mysterious rumors floating around on floor 666 of a mysterious company. The player must navigate through the office, avoiding the enemy and solving puzzles to escape. Use your camera to gather evidence and uncover the secrets within this shady company. The game is designed to be played on Oculus Quest, but should run on other major headsets. The game is currently in development with no known release date, as it is quite an ambitious passion project of mine.

  • Floor 666: A VR Horror Experience

    Floor 666 is a Meta Quest horror game, featuring an interactive world, full body IK, and a (kinda) smart enemy. The player must navigate through the office, avoiding the enemy and solving puzzles to escape. Use your camera to gather evidence and uncover the secrets within this shady company. The game is designed to be played on Oculus Quest, but should run on other major headsets. The game is currently in development with no known release date.

  • Language Bridge

    Language Bridge is a real-time translation application that connects users from different linguistic backgrounds, allowing them to communicate seamlessly, powered by artificial intelligence. Users can send messages in their preferred language, and the LLM automatically translates them into the recipient's language in real-time. This project is built with NextJS, Socket.io, and powered by Mistral.AI's LLM.

  • Single Threat

    Single Threat is a survival base-building game focused on not getting killed. By who? Zombies, of course. This project is built in Unity using C# and Unity Asset Store. This is a work in progress as it is a massive project. Currently, there are no playable builds as the game is in a very early development stage.

  • Game Dev Diaries

    Game Dev Diaries is an innovative application tailored for game developers—a dynamic platform designed for sharing their game-building journey! Boasting a sleek, modern UI and robust backend functionalities, including account management, seamless post creation, secure authentication, and personalized user profiles. Built with NextJS, Firebase, and Tailwind.

  • PictoJS

    PictoJS is a Nintendo DS PictoChat-inspired messaging app. Send drawings across the network on top of a unique retro-looking GUI. Built with NodeJS, EJS, and Socket.io.

  • Blood Moon

    This game is about a little guy trying to navigate through a mysterious world, using only his flashlight. He needs to reach a mysterious door at the end of the level as fast as possible. This game was built as part of the Pixel Game Jam 2023.

Let's Connect

Interested in discussing opportunities or have any inquiries? Let's connect! Reach out to explore how my skills can benefit your project or to discuss potential collaborations. Looking forward to hearing from you!

Github IconLinkedin Icon